Certificate in Managing Diversity in Hospitality holds significant importance in today's market, particularly in the UK. According to a survey by the Chartered Institute of Personnel and Development (CIPD), 75% of UK employers believe that diversity and inclusion are crucial for business success. Moreover, a report by the UK's Office for National Statistics (ONS) states that companies with diverse workforces are more likely to outperform their competitors.
| Year |
Percentage of Employed People from Minority Ethnic Groups |
| 2011 |
11.9% |
| 2016 |
14.3% |
| 2020 |
17.4% |
